1. Weight and Stiffness: The Perfect Balance
One of the standout features of **carbon MTB handlebars** is their exceptional strength-to-weight ratio. Riders often seek handlebars that provide maximum stiffness while minimizing weight. The stiffness of the handlebars directly influences your ability to maintain control during aggressive riding. Lighter handlebars enhance your climbing efficiency, while stiffer options improve power transfer during sprints. Look for handlebars that balance these two aspects effectively, ensuring that you can tackle technical trails without compromising on performance.

4. Width and Rise Preferences: Tailoring to Your Riding Style
Choosing the right **width and rise** of your handlebars is essential for optimizing your riding position and control. Wider handlebars offer more stability and leverage, particularly on technical terrain. In contrast, narrower options may provide better aerodynamics for racing. The rise of the handlebars also affects your riding posture; higher rises can improve control on descents, while lower rises may favor a more aggressive riding stance.

5. Clamp Diameter: The 35mm Advantage
The **35mm clamp diameter** has gained popularity among mountain bikers for its added strength and stiffness. Compared to traditional 31.8mm clamps, the 35mm diameter offers increased surface area for better grip on the stem. This feature can enhance steering precision and overall handling of the bike.
Compatibility with Other Components
Ensure that your chosen handlebars are compatible with your existing bike setup. While most modern bikes accommodate 35mm handlebars, it’s essential to verify compatibility with your stem and other components to avoid installation issues.

FAQs
1. What are the benefits of using carbon handlebars over aluminum?
Carbon handlebars are lighter and generally provide better vibration dampening and stiffness compared to aluminum, resulting in improved overall performance.
2. How do I determine the right width for my handlebars?
Your ideal handlebar width depends on your riding style and personal comfort. Wider bars offer more stability, while narrower bars can enhance aerodynamics for racing.
3. Are 35mm handlebars compatible with all bike stems?
Not all bike stems are compatible with 35mm handlebars. Always verify compatibility before purchasing.
4. How can I maintain my carbon MTB handlebars?
Regularly inspect your handlebars for signs of wear or damage. Clean them with a mild soap solution and avoid harsh chemicals that could harm the carbon material.
5. Do carbon handlebars have a weight limit?
While carbon handlebars are incredibly strong, they do have weight limits. Always check the manufacturer's specifications to ensure you stay within the recommended limits.
